Output 74a8d587a0ec6b873316e8b4073cabeabdb0aae3416e018bd7648f8643332151:1

value
33754546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30496f31a0617246c059567767112e1905d278bd OP_EQUAL
address
MCJUdwqHVbzoj5uhRgBLCsEFXFLCRfMMM7
transaction
74a8d587a0ec6b873316e8b4073cabeabdb0aae3416e018bd7648f8643332151
spent
true